Understanding ASINs on Amazon

Before we dive into the details of merging ASINs, let’s first understand what an ASIN is. ASIN stands for Amazon Standard Identification Number, and it is a unique identifier assigned to each product on Amazon. It serves as a universal product identifier and helps Amazon categorize and track products throughout its vast marketplace.

How to Merge ASINs on Amazon

Once you have identified duplicate ASINs and gathered all the necessary information, you can initiate the merge request on Amazon. Navigating the Amazon Seller Central is essential for successfully merging ASINs. By following the step-by-step process outlined by Amazon, you can ensure a seamless merging experience.

During the merging process, there are a few key steps to keep in mind. Firstly, you will need to select the source ASIN and target ASIN for merging. The source ASIN is the duplicate ASIN you want to merge, while the target ASIN is the primary ASIN that will remain active. It is important to choose the correct ASINs to avoid any unintentional changes to your product listings.

Once you have selected the source ASIN and target ASIN, you will need to review and confirm the merge request. Take your time to thoroughly check all the details to ensure accuracy. After confirming the merge request, Amazon will process the merge and update your product listings accordingly.

Potential Challenges in Merging ASINs

While merging ASINs can greatly benefit your Amazon business, it is important to be aware of potential challenges that may arise during the process. One common challenge is dealing with errors. It is possible that errors can occur during the merging process, resulting in unintended changes to your product listings. To mitigate this risk, it is recommended to double-check all the details and seek assistance from Amazon Seller Support if needed.

Another challenge to consider is understanding the implications of merging ASINs. Merging ASINs can impact various aspects of your product listings, such as product reviews and rankings. It is crucial to understand how merging ASINs can affect your business and take necessary steps to minimize any negative consequences.
